Using the cervical ripening balloon as a midwifery tool can effectively promote the softening and dilation of the cervix to a certain extent, which helps to improve the smooth progress of delivery. However, there are still certain risks in its application process, among which the most concerned is the potential risk of cervical injury and infection. Although the cervical ripening balloon is a clinically proven medical device, improper use, operational errors or individual differences among patients may lead to some adverse consequences, especially in terms of cervical injury or infection.
The occurrence of cervical injury is often closely related to the inflation pressure of the balloon and the operation method during the expansion process. When the cervical ripening balloon is inserted and inflated, although its design goal is to promote cervical softening and dilation, if the inflation pressure is too high, it may cause mechanical damage to the cervical tissue. As a flexible and elastic structure, the cervix may cause cervical wall tearing, bleeding or other injuries if it is subjected to excessive pressure or expansion, especially when the cervix itself is fragile or there are already lesions, the risk of injury will be greater.
Cervical injury may also be caused by improper operation techniques. Although the cervical ripening balloon is usually operated by professionally trained medical personnel, it is not impossible for operational errors to occur in clinical practice. For example, improper operation, excessive force or improper installation of the device during insertion may cause damage to the cervix.
Regarding the risk of infection, the application of cervical ripening balloons also has certain hidden dangers. The cervix is an important barrier connecting the uterus with the outside world. As an invasive operation, the insertion and expansion process of the cervical ripening balloon may destroy the natural defense line of the cervix and increase the chance of bacteria or other pathogens entering the uterine cavity. During the operation, if the aseptic operation procedures are not strictly followed, intubation or improper operation may lead to infection. Especially when the patient's own immunity is weak or there are other sources of infection, the risk of infection will be further increased.
In order to reduce the risk of cervical injury and infection, strict screening is required when selecting indications. Only when it is determined that the patient's cervical status is suitable for the use of cervical ripening balloons can relevant operations be performed. At the same time, strict aseptic operation is the key to preventing infection. During the entire operation, medical staff should wear sterile gloves, use sterile operating tools, and keep the environment clean. In addition, precise control of balloon pressure is also crucial. Excessive inflation pressure will not only cause damage, but also may cause rupture of cervical blood vessels, bleeding and other complications.
